ANNANDALE, Minn. — The Malco Group, a manufacturer of tools for the HVACR and building construction trades, has opened nominations for its national Trade Pro of the Year Award program.
Now in its ninth year, the Trade Pro of the Year Award recognizes outstanding trade professionals in the U.S. who are dedicated to the HVACR industry or building construction industry, as well as to on-the-job safety and giving back to their communities, a press release from Malco said.
The top five winners from throughout the U.S. will receive $1,000 worth of products of their choosing from The Malco Group, including from brands like Unilite, C&D Valve, Beckett, ACE Chemical, and Malco Tools. All qualifying trade professionals who are nominated will receive a Malco cap. Trade pros are encouraged to self-nominate, or nominate a fellow professional, for the honor.
“HVACR and building construction professionals do expert work across the country, and The Malco Group wants to celebrate their accomplishments,” said Rebecca Talbot, vice president of marketing at The Malco Group. “These outstanding individuals deserve recognition of their exceptional work in their profession.”
As a supporter and advocate of careers in the trades, The Malco Group donates significant quantities of in-kind products and apparel annually to a variety of skilled trades education programs, competitions, and events across the country, including high school, post-secondary technical and apprenticeship programs, regional apprenticeship contests, and SkillsUSA state and national conferences.
